Top Tips for Litter Box Hygiene for Happy Cats
Keeping your kitty's litter box clean is crucial for their satisfaction. A tidy litter box will encourage them to use it, preventing accidents around your home.
Here are some essential tips:
* Clean the litter box at least once twice a day. This will help reduce odor and keep things hygienic.
* Thoroughly clean the litter box with soap and water at least every seven days. Be sure to rinse it well and allow it to air dry.
* Choose the best type of litter for your cat. Cat bed Some cats like clay litter, while others do better with clumping or natural litters.
* Place the litter box in a private location where your cat will feel secure. Avoid areas that are trafficked.
The Purrfect Guide to Litter Box Bliss
A clean and accessible litter box is crucial for keeping your feline friend happy and healthy. Here are some tips to ensure your kitty's bathroom experience is always a pawsitive one: Pick a suitable litter box|your cat should be able to turn around comfortably inside without feeling cramped. Always maintaining the litter box at least once a day will help keep odors under control and prevent your cat from avoiding it. Discover various litter options|some cats prefer unscented litters, while others enjoy scented varieties. Place the litter box in a quiet, low-traffic area where your cat feels comfortable. Avoid placing it near food and water bowls to prevent contamination.
- Ensure adequate litter box access|the general rule is one litter box per cat, plus one extra.
- Keep the litter box clean and fresh|this will encourage your cat to use it consistently.
